Ammonium Bicarbonate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Ammonium Bicarbonate Market Size was estimated at 1.354 USD Billion in 2024. The Ammonium Bicarbonate industry is projected to grow from 1.395 USD Billion in 2025 to 1.871 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.98 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Ammonium Bicarbonate Market Drivers

Industrial Versatility

The Ammonium Bicarbonate Market benefits from its versatility across various industrial applications. This compound is utilized not only in agriculture but also in food processing, pharmaceuticals, and chemical manufacturing. For instance, in the food industry, ammonium bicarbonate serves as a leavening agent, contributing to the production of baked goods. The food processing sector has been projected to grow at a CAGR of around 4% over the next few years, which could enhance the demand for ammonium bicarbonate. Additionally, its role in the production of certain pharmaceuticals and as a pH regulator in various chemical processes further underscores its importance. This multifaceted utility positions ammonium bicarbonate as a critical component in diverse industrial sectors, thereby driving its market growth.

Regional Insights

North America : Market Leader in Production

North America is the largest market for ammonium bicarbonate, holding approximately 40% of the global share. The region benefits from robust agricultural practices and a growing demand for fertilizers, driven by the need for sustainable farming solutions. Regulatory support for environmentally friendly products further catalyzes market growth, with initiatives aimed at reducing carbon footprints and enhancing soil health. The United States and Canada are the leading countries in this region, with major players like CF Industries Holdings, Inc. and Nutrien Ltd. dominating the landscape. The competitive environment is characterized by significant investments in production capacity and innovation. The presence of established companies ensures a steady supply chain, meeting the increasing demand for ammonium bicarbonate in agricultural applications.

Europe : Sustainable Agriculture Focus

Europe is the second-largest market for ammonium bicarbonate, accounting for around 30% of the global market share. The region's growth is driven by stringent regulations promoting sustainable agricultural practices and the use of eco-friendly fertilizers. The European Union's Green Deal and Farm to Fork strategy are pivotal in shaping demand, encouraging the adoption of ammonium bicarbonate as a viable alternative to traditional fertilizers. Leading countries in Europe include Germany, France, and the Netherlands, where companies like K+S Aktiengesellschaft and Yara International ASA are key players. The competitive landscape is marked by innovation and a focus on sustainability, with firms investing in research and development to enhance product efficiency. The presence of regulatory bodies ensures compliance with environmental standards, fostering a responsible market environment.

Asia-Pacific : Emerging Market Potential

Asia-Pacific is witnessing significant growth in the ammonium bicarbonate market, driven by increasing agricultural activities and rising food demand. The region holds approximately 25% of the global market share, with countries like China and India leading the charge. The growing population and urbanization are key factors driving the need for efficient fertilizers, supported by government initiatives to enhance agricultural productivity. China is the largest producer and consumer of ammonium bicarbonate, with companies like Shandong Hualu Hengsheng Chemical Co., Ltd. playing a crucial role. The competitive landscape is evolving, with both local and international players vying for market share. Investments in technology and production capacity are on the rise, ensuring a steady supply to meet the burgeoning demand in the agricultural sector.
